Country Basics | fishing shack in the Caribbean |
Belize is located in Central America bordering Mexico, Guatemala and Honduras. The country is governed by the parliamentary democracy and Queen Elizabeth is the chief of state. The most widely spoken language is English, although I was glad to also know Spanish, as it came in handy. When I visited, the Belizean dollar, was about 2:1 American dollars.
The first portion of my trip was spent on the island of San Pedro, and the second half of the trip was spent in San Ignacio. San Pedro offered a beach paradise, surrounded by the Caribbean Sea. San Ignacio is located in a mountainous region forested with lush tropical jungle. |
